Bathroom Taps A Brief History
Water for baths, sinks and basins can be provided by separate hot and cold taps; this arrangement is common in older installations, particularly in public washrooms/lavatories and utility rooms/laundries. In kitchens and bathrooms mixer taps are commonly used. In this case, hot and cold water from the two valves is mixed before reaching the outlet, allowing the water to emerge at any temperature between that of the hot and cold water supplies. Mixer taps were invented by Thomas Campbell of Saint John, New Brunswick and patented in 1880. For baths and showers, mixer taps frequently incorporate some sort of pressure balancing feature so that the hot/cold mixture ratio will not be affected by transient changes in the pressure of one or the other of the supplies. This helps avoid scalding or uncomfortable chilling as other water loads occur (such as the flushing of a toilet). Rather than two separate valves, mixer taps frequently use a single, more complex, valve controlled by a single handle (single handle mixer). The handle moves up and down to control the amount of water flow and from side to side to control the temperature of the water. Especially for baths and showers, the latest designs do this using a built in thermostat. These are known as thermostatic mixing valves, or TMVs, and can be mechanical or electronic.

Hudson Reed

The growth over the last 25 years has seen the company expand from a small operation in a former air raid shelter to premises boasting a state of the art distribution centre employing over 100 people. The Company began life offering a plating service but quickly progressed to be one of the largest independent suppliers of taps and showers. The ability to offer the most popular styles at affordable prices followed as the company mantra. More recently we have seen the introduction of a comprehensive heating range, a wide offering of mirror and cabinets and now, the launch of new furniture. The ability to offer complete co-ordination for the bathroom makes Hudson Reed a popular choice. Over the last 10 years the Company has achieved the widely recognised ‘Investors in People’ status along with ISO9001 accreditation, both ensuring Customer Service and product quality are at the forefront of the business. This is supported by a 20 year market leading guarantee (unless otherwise stated) and the commitment to seek relevant product approvals.
